Chapter 227 - Chapter 227: Searching for Desert's Sorrow

For two consecutive days, the Konoha group had nearly searched every corner of Sunagakure, especially areas with environments suitable for Desert's Sorrow to grow—but they found nothing.

The remaining possibilities lay near the Kazekage Building.

The Kazekage Building was heavily guarded. Moreover, the Main Road leading to the building was a restricted zone, as previously warned by the Suna ninja—if outsiders stepped onto it, even civilians would be killed without mercy.

However, they couldn't afford to wait any longer. They only had one more day before they'd have to leave Sunagakure.

Otherwise, they'd raise suspicions among the Suna ninja.

Even Sakumo Hatake wouldn't be able to approach during daylight.

Therefore, for this group from Konoha, their final chance was tonight...

...

The sun slipped below the horizon, and soon the world was bathed in moonlight, swallowed once again by night.

Inside the house where the Konoha ninja resided.

Six people gathered here. Among them, Sakumo Hatake, Minato, Hyuga Kubei, and Junko Watanabe had removed their disguises.

The three exchanged glances before Minato formed hand seals with both hands.

As soon as the sequence ended, he pressed his palm to his abdomen.

Without stopping, his hands moved like shadows, forming another seal, then pressing onto Junko Watanabe's abdomen.

Junko's hidden chakra surged through her body like a gushing spring, though due to Hyuga Kubei's [Gentle Fist] [Pressure Point Strike], her chakra flow remained slightly obstructed at present.

Still, such sealing techniques could no longer restrict Junko now that her Chakra Seal had been released. Her eyes darkened with focus. With sheer willpower, she forced her chakra through the blockages.

At the same time, she formed seals with both hands, causing visible seal formations to spread throughout the room, forming a barrier.

"Alright, let's begin."

After setting up the barrier, Junko spoke. At this point, they no longer feared eavesdroppers—this barrier not only concealed their spiritual presence but also muted sound according to Junko's will.

The reason they first removed the seal on Junko was because she possessed the ability to create barriers that shield against chakra perception.

Now back to full strength, Minato observed Junko's technique with admiration in his heart. Apart from the methods unique to the Uzumaki clan, Junko's barrier already ranked among the higher levels of sealing techniques.

As the weakest among the Five Great Ninja Villages, Sunagakure lagged far behind—not just economically and militarily, but also regarding the number and variety of Ninjutsu and secret techniques available—compared to Konoha.

After all, Konoha was founded through cooperation between the two strongest clans in the ninja world—Uchiha and Senju. The other powerful clans residing in the village, including Hyūga, Sarutobi, Yamanaka, Nara, and Akimichi, were all formidable forces.

It was precisely because of so many powerful clans coexisting that Konoha had retained its position as the top ninja village for generations—untouchable and enduring.

That was the true depth of Konoha's legacy.

Once Junko completed the barrier, Minato also used his own chakra to unblock the pressure points inside his body.

The past few days of suppressing his natural chakra reserves had indeed been quite uncomfortable.

Then, Minato released the seals on Hatake Sakumo, Hyuga Kubei, Mikoto, and Hanyu Yamanaka. Except for Mikoto, whose bindings had to be removed by Hyuga Kubei, the other two broke free on their own.

They were about to begin their operation.

"Mikoto, Senior Hanyu, you two stay here temporarily while we go searching for Desert's Sorrow," Minato said. Over the past few days, they'd scoured every inch of Sunagakure and figured out the shift rotations of the surrounding Suna ninja.

The four of them planned to exploit this moment and slip into the central main road of Sunagakure to locate Desert's Sorrow.

Among the six, Mikoto had the weakest mobility and was most likely to be discovered. Hanyu Yamanaka's abilities could kill silently and invisibly; so if Mikoto ever encountered danger, his skills could ensure both remained undetected temporarily.

Once Desert's Sorrow was located, at dawn the next day, the group must leave Sunagakure immediately.

After exiting Sky Crack into the desert, even if Sunagakure sent trackers after them, it would be like chasing shadows in the dunes.

Both nodded in agreement.

Of these four, Sakumo possessed the greatest strength. Junko Watanabe's ability shielded them from enemy sensing ninjas, and Minato's speed was fast enough to assist Hyuga Kubei in instantly taking down enemies.

With the two working together, aside from the Third Kazekage, no current ninja in Sunagakure could withstand them for more than a moment.

All that remained now was to wait.

...

The night deepened, yet everyone still chatted casually as usual, attempting to relax their enemies' vigilance.

Then suddenly, Sakumo and the others heard faint noises coming from the rooftops around them.

An ordinary person wouldn't have noticed such things, but to ninja of jonin level, these sounds were clearly perceptible.

"Move!" Suddenly, Hatake Sakumo shot open his eyes.

Shua Shua Shua!

In a flash, the four of them vanished from the room.

...

Junko Watanabe pressed her right index and middle fingers together, raising them vertically in front of her face.

This wasn't forming hand seals—it was focusing her concentration. She was sensing the positions of nearby Suna ninja and guiding the Konoha team to continuously evade detection.

Yet she also had to watch out for Suna's sensing ninjas, which demanded extreme concentration.

Actually, after so much training over this extended period, Minato's once-lost sensory ability had mostly recovered—otherwise he wouldn't dare casually attempt using the Flying Thunder God Technique again.

Still, unless absolutely necessary, Minato preferred not to reveal his presence and risk being noticed.

With the fighting skills of the four and Junko Watanabe's guidance as a sensing ninja, their progress was surprisingly smooth.

However, the closer they came to that main road, the slower their pace became—they knew there might be many guards where Desert's Sorrow grew.

Besides, it lay very near the Kazekage Building itself.

Shua! Shua!

Under cover of darkness, the four leapt onto the rooftops along one side of the main road within Suna, hiding behind the eaves.

This area was nearly the only place still brightly lit in the silent, late-night Sand Village...

Inside one of the rooms of the Kazekage Building was the office of the Third Kazekage.

So upon arriving here, Junko Watanabe immediately narrowed her sensory range to just a few meters around her. This was not only to avoid detection by the guards but also out of caution towards the Third Kazekage.

After all, he was the Third Kazekage—the Kage of an entire village and a top-tier powerhouse throughout the Ninja World.

As they drew closer to the Kazekage Building, the four grew more cautious—it was becoming harder to observe without being noticed.

At this critical moment, Minato's mind was suddenly interrupted by an abrupt voice—the voice of "Senior Minato."

"Expand your senses and detect natural energy."

Minato flinched at those words, his mind racing. "But I've never even practiced Sage Mode!" he thought, bewildered.

Minato had once mastered the perfect Sage Mode. However, due to his relatively limited chakra reserves and his usual combat style, he rarely used it.

Yet again, a voice rang out from deep within his soul.

"The Nine-Tails' chakra itself has the ability to sense natural energy!"
